Security Analysis

Security Analysis is the systematic process of identifying, assessing, and mitigating vulnerabilities and threats in software, systems, or networks to protect against cyber attacks. It involves techniques like vulnerability scanning, penetration testing, and risk assessment to evaluate security posture. The goal is to ensure confidentiality, integrity, and availability of assets by proactively addressing security weaknesses.

🧊Why learn Security Analysis?

Developers should learn Security Analysis to build secure applications and comply with regulations like GDPR or HIPAA, especially in industries like finance or healthcare where data breaches are costly. It's essential for roles in DevSecOps, cybersecurity, or when developing software that handles sensitive user data, as it helps prevent common attacks such as SQL injection or cross-site scripting (XSS).
